On July 18, 2026, the European Commission formally activated the second phase of the Carbon Border Adjustment Mechanism (CBAM), bringing a new reporting requirement into immediate focus for importers of steel, aluminum, and cement entering the EU. By October 31, 2026, importers must submit embedded emissions data covering production from January to June 2026 and have that information checked by EU-ETS-recognized verification bodies. From an industry perspective, importers are likely to feel the first operational impact because the reporting obligation sits directly alongside customs and entry compliance. The practical pressure point is not only filing on time, but ensuring the underlying production emissions data can be obtained, organized, and accepted in a verifiable form. What deserves closer attention is whether each shipment-linked supply arrangement can support that documentation chain without delaying market entry or increasing procedural risk.
Analysis shows that non-EU manufacturers supplying the EU market, including Chinese exporters in steel, aluminum, and cement, are likely to come under greater pressure from customers for production-stage emissions records. For these suppliers, the immediate issue is less about public positioning and more about whether plant-level or process-level information can be delivered in a form that supports importer submissions and third-party verification. In business terms, this can affect supplier qualification and continuity of orders.
Observably, the requirement also reaches procurement and finance functions because emissions reporting now interacts with cost visibility and sourcing decisions. Where embedded emissions data become part of transaction readiness, buyers may need to compare suppliers not only on price and delivery, but also on the completeness and verifiability of supporting data. This is especially relevant when supply contracts involve Steel Alloys or Refining Sys-related delivery structures in which downstream responsibility may shift.
For logistics coordinators, trade service providers, and other intermediaries, the likely impact lies in document flow, deadline control, and communication across importer-supplier-verifier relationships. The business risk is not that these parties become the regulated filer themselves based on the provided information, but that weak coordination around supporting records could affect clearance timing, customer commitments, and overall execution reliability.
